Building Your API Intelligence Network

Strategic Data Integration

The foundation of modern marketing automation lies in building a comprehensive view of your target accounts. By leveraging APIs, successful teams are combining firmographic data streams with real-time growth indicators and sophisticated digital footprint analysis. This creates a dynamic intelligence network that continuously monitors and responds to market opportunities.

Consider how leading sales teams are using this approach: When a prospect company shows multiple positive signals – perhaps a combination of increased website visits, recent funding announcement, and engagement with competitive content – the system automatically adjusts targeting parameters and messaging strategy. This level of sophistication simply isn't possible without robust API integration.

The Essential API Infrastructure

Market Intelligence Foundation

The backbone of effective automation starts with comprehensive market intelligence. Leading teams are combining data from multiple specialized APIs to create a complete picture of their market. Meltwater provides real-time market monitoring, while AlphaSense delivers crucial business signals. Owler offers competitive intelligence, and BuiltWith tracks technology stack changes. The magic happens when these data streams work in concert to trigger intelligent automation workflows.

Engagement Analytics Evolution

Modern engagement tracking has evolved far beyond simple page views and email opens. Through strategic API integration with tools like Mixpanel for user flows and Pendo for product usage analysis, teams are building sophisticated engagement profiles that inform every automated interaction. This deep understanding of prospect behavior enables truly personalized automation at scale.

Advanced Automation Frameworks

The real power of API-driven automation emerges when you begin combining multiple data signals to create sophisticated decision engines. Leading teams are building systems that combine intent data with engagement scores, mix firmographic changes with behavioral signals, and integrate market events with account activity. This creates a compound effect where each additional data point multiplies the effectiveness of your automation.
